Alert: WS-COMPRESS-HIGH-CPU (Tidemark gateway)

This fires when per-message deflate pushes gateway CPU above threshold. Context for new contractors: compression saves bandwidth on chatty websocket channels but costs CPU per frame, so under load we selectively disable it for small payloads. If this alert fires, do not disable compression globally — it will saturate egress. Instead, adjust the payload-size cutoff per the tuning guidance documented on our internal operations page.

operations page: https://jenkins.zemvarcloud.local/job/merge_requests/repo/build/73930b4b30f0a8ed

**Vendor note: Inkmill markdown pipeline**

Rendering for Parchway docs is outsourced to Inkmill under an annual contract, renewing each March. They handle sanitization and PDF export; we own the upload queue. SLA: 4-hour response on rendering failures. Escalate only after two failed retries. Their support desk is reachable at the address below.

billing contact of hahaf-baguf = zorael.tammir.jorius@sivrelhq.internal

### Cache Invalidation for the Tradewind Catalog

As release manager, you own the invalidation sweep that runs after every catalog publish. Tradewind caches product detail pages at three layers — edge, regional, and the in-process LRU — and all three must be purged in that order, or stale prices can reappear for up to an hour. The purge job is triggered by a signed request to the cache controller; it rejects anything unsigned. The key authorized for purge requests is shown below.

release key, kawif-hawep: bky13_X7TGuRG4Zu4ZJ